
Reserve Firefighter
The Orange County Fire Authority is seeking qualified members of our community to serve as Reserve Firefighters. Reserve Firefighters provide a valuable service to their communities by assisting Career Firefighters at a variety of emergencies including structure fires, medical emergencies, traffic collisions, floods, rescues, and a variety of other types of emergencies.

Reserve Firefighter Functions
Engine Companies
Level 1 Reserves assigned to Engine Companies receive training to respond to structure fires, wildland fires, traffic collisions, incident support, and medical aid emergencies.
Patrols
Level 2 Reserves assigned to Patrols receive training to respond to wildland fires, traffic collisions, incident support, and medical aid emergencies.
Wildland Support Unit and Station 41
Reserve Firecrew members assigned to Stations 18 and 41 receive training in wildland firefighting and special equipment operation.
Stations
Reserve Firefighters at Stations 7, 10 and 16 may also operate water tenders.
**Reserve Firefighters are required to attend at least 50% of drill nights and 100% of mandatory quarterly trainings.
